description abstractAbstractReliable and efficient pipeline networks are crucial for supplying natural gas to end users. Pipeline networks are cost-effective but susceptible to numerous risks, notably corrosion, natural hazards, and human-induced interventions, leading to ...Practical ApplicationsThis study presents a spatial analysis framework that utilizes historical failure data and GIS-based techniques to identify high-risk zones in natural gas pipeline networks.
